Output 102a84a0e7110a51b6f5555417c2314fa66fc87a4f5829b93e201083e1928347:0

value
650477
script pubkey
OP_0 OP_PUSHBYTES_20 06ed173b510e6869524abc32a4d1303bd52d2758
address
bc1qqmk3ww63pe5xj5j2hse2f5fs802j6f6cmn9fkf
transaction
102a84a0e7110a51b6f5555417c2314fa66fc87a4f5829b93e201083e1928347
confirmations
153191
spent
true